What is Glycinate?
Glycinate refers to a compound formed when glycine, an amino acid, binds with a mineral, such as magnesium or zinc. The result is a chelated form of the mineral, which is believed to enhance absorption and bioavailability in the body. Among glycinate supplements, magnesium glycinate is the most commonly discussed due to its notable benefits.
Benefits of Glycinate Supplements
1. Improved Absorption
One of the primary advantages of glycinate supplements is their superior absorption rate compared to other forms of minerals. When minerals are chelated with amino acids like glycine, they are more easily absorbed in the intestines. This means you can reap the benefits without needing to consume high doses.
2. Supports Relaxation and Sleep
Magnesium is well-known for its role in promoting relaxation and reducing anxiety. Magnesium glycinate, in particular, is often recommended for those looking to enhance their sleep quality. Its calming effects can help ease tension in the body and mind, making it easier to drift off to sleep.
3. Muscle Function and Recovery
Athletes and active individuals may benefit from glycinate supplements as well. Magnesium plays a crucial role in muscle function, and supplementation can help reduce muscle cramps and improve recovery times after intense exercise.
4. Bone Health
Magnesium is an essential mineral for bone health, working alongside calcium and vitamin D to maintain strong bones. Supplementing with magnesium glycinate can support overall bone density and strength, making it particularly beneficial for older adults.
Potential Side Effects
While glycinate supplements are generally considered safe, it’s essential to be aware of potential side effects. Some individuals may experience digestive issues, such as diarrhea or upset stomach, particularly if taken in high doses. It’s advisable to start with a lower dose and gradually increase as needed while monitoring your body’s response.
Additionally, individuals with certain health conditions or those on specific medications should consult with a healthcare professional before beginning any new supplement regimen.
